web-dev-qa-db-ja.com

Freebsd(Freenas 8)とrobocopyはエラー5タイムスタンプの宛先ファイルを与えるのはなぜですか?

私はNAS FreeBSD/FreeNas8.0.4を実行しています/ updateファイル

Robocopyで同じことを試みたとき。コマンドに応じて、2つのエラーのいずれかが発生します。

robocopy .\ \\freenas\temp *.* /FFT
2011/06/15 21:17:58 ERROR 5 (0x00000005) Time-Stamping Destination File \\freenas\temp\test.txt
Access is denied.

robocopy .\ \\freenas\temp *.* /COPY:DA
2011/06/15 21:18:08 ERROR 5 (0x00000005) Changing File Attributes \\freenas\temp\
Access is denied.

デフォルトの設定から、smb.confに次のように設定しました

[share]
map archive = yes

[global]
dos filetimes = yes

他の手がかりはありますか?

1
Jafin

/COPY:DTを使用して、ファイル属性ではなく、データとタイムスタンプ情報のみをコピーしてみてください。おそらく、/FFTスイッチも使い続ける必要があります。

1
rossnz

この問題は、RDPクライアントネットワーク共有を介してWindows Server 2008R2マシンからWindowsServer 2003ドメインコントローラーにコピーする際に発生しました(例:\\tsclient\D)。

Windows Server 2003リソースキット(XP010)の古いバージョンのrobocopyを使用すると、正常に機能しました。

1
John Anson

最初に再起動可能モード/Zでコピーし、失敗した場合はバックアップモード/Bをコピーしてみてください。そのため、パラメータ/ZBを追加して、何が起こるかをお知らせください。それ かもしれない あなたの問題を解決しますが、保証はありません。私はまた、あなたがあなたの許可とすべてのコーシャを持っていると確信しています。

0
songei2f